Course Description

Learn step-by-step how to transform a simple nursery plant into a bonsai with great potential. Choosing the front view, tree style, selecting trunk lines, pruning, initial shaping, repotting… each key step is explained in detail. This comprehensive course is designed for both curious beginners and passionate enthusiasts looking to refine their technique. Instructor for this course

Alexandre ESCUDERO

Manager of BONSAÏ SHOHIN
Founder of the BONSAÏ DO and AÏKA-EN schools
Alexandre Escudero was introduced to bonsai in the 1990s through his mother, but it wasn’t until the 2000s that he developed a serious interest in the art and began training under skilled professionals. Three key figures have greatly influenced his work with trees: Mr. Hiroyuki Tanibata, from whom he learned in Japan at his Shoukaen garden, as well as here in France over a period of five years; Frédéric Chenal, who welcomed him into his garden for seven years as an unconventional apprentice; and Marco Invernizzi, with whom he has been working for the past three years.
